Tested successfully on SwiftBar. Retrieves API key from shell config files if present, otherwise display an error message

Tested successfully on SwiftBar
If user changes value of VAR_STARTING_DATE to a non-zero number, the menu bar will display "Poe: <credits left> (est.: <credits expected under regular usage>)". This allows the user to monitor if he/she is underspending or overspending their credits.

Also: 
- link to detailed instructions on how to configure the plugin.
- more precise estimate of balance expected assuming average use (DAYS is a fractional number now)
- Embed base64-encoded Poe icon (POE_ICON) for visual display in menu bar
- Add <xbar.image> metadata pointing to GitHub cover image
- Replace "Poe:" text prefix with icon using templateImage= parameter
- Enable automatic light/dark mode adaptation via SwiftBar templateImage
- Update all output lines to use new format: "<text> | templateImage=$POE_ICON"

The icon is a black template that automatically adapts to macOS appearance:
- White icon in Dark Mode
- Black icon in Light Mode
